Specifically, it is the policy and practice of the Employer to accurately <br />compensate employees and to do so in compliance with all applicable state and federal <br />laws. The Utilities will never knowingly fail or refuse to pay an employee the full amount <br />of compensation to which he or she is entitled by law for work performed on behalf of the <br />Utilities. <br />ALL EMPLOYEES <br />Protection of Employee Rights <br />The Employer will protect the right of each employee to receive compensation according <br />to the law. Violations of this Fair Pay Policy, whether by a managerial or non-managerial <br />employee, may result in disciplinary action, if appropriate under the circumstances, up to <br />and including termination of employment. <br />The Employer will not tolerate or allow any form of retaliation against individuals who <br />report alleged or suspected violations of this policy or who cooperate in the <br />investigation of such reports. Retaliation is unacceptable, and any form of retaliation in <br />violation of this policy will result in disciplinary action, up to and including termination. <br />Record Your Time And Review Your Pay Stub <br />To ensure that you are paid properly for all time worked and that no improper deductions <br />are made, you must record correctly all work time and review your paychecks promptly to <br />identify and to report all errors. <br />The Employer makes every effort to ensure that its employees are paid correctly. <br />Occasionally, however, inadvertent mistakes can happen.
